    One of these nights Eagles song.This was releases by The Eagles in 1975 and written by Don Henley and Glen Frey.It reached No 1 in the billboars charts and is a favourite among their fans.
    It also has a brilliant story line with incredible lyrics.

      Correction: Randy sang lead on several Eagles songs, and he wrote some of their hits too. To name a few songs with Randy on lead vocals:
      = Most of us are sad
      = Midnight Flyer (co-written with Bernie Leadon)
      = Too Many Hands (co-written with Don Felder)
      = Tryin’ (Randy’s composition)
      = Certain Kind of Fool (Randy’s composition)
      = Try and Love Again (Randy’s composition)
      … and of course Take It To The Limit, which was Randy’s composition too. He was writing it in his own creative way and in his own creative time, when the Egoes pulled their “let us help you finish it” trick (which they did to many other songwriters) - so they could get their names on the credits as well as on the royalty checks. Take It To The Limit was Eagles’ first million-seller even though it was not promoted nor released as a single … now imagine if the Egoes had given Randy more of the limelight, we would have had many many more hits.
      Randy also wrote and sang many great songs both pre-Eagles and post-Eagles.
